We show a reduction of Hilbert’s tenth problem to the solvability of the matrix equation A1 1 A i2 2 · · ·A ik k = Z over non-commuting integral matrices, where Z is the zero matrix, thus proving that the solvability of the equation is undecidable. This is in contrast to the case whereby the matrix semigroup is commutative in which the solvability of the same equation was shown to be decidable ...

We prove that for any n × n matrix, A, and z with |z| ≥ ‖A‖, we have that ‖(z − A)−1‖ ≤ cot( π 4n )dist(z, spec(A)). We apply this result to the study of random orthogonal polynomials on the unit circle.
